Buffalo Bills Seek Fan Assistance for Snow Removal Ahead of Final Regular-Season Game
1/1/2026, 11:32:26 PM
Snowfall and Game Context
As the Buffalo Bills prepare for their final regular-season game at Highmark Stadium against the New York Jets on Sunday, the team is calling on fans to assist with snow removal from the stands. Following a significant snowfall of approximately 10.5 inches in Orchard Park on Wednesday, the Bills are seeking volunteers to help clear the stadium on Saturday, with the first shift starting at 8 a.m. EST. This game is particularly notable as it may be the last at the current stadium, with the Bills only competing for wild-card seeding in the playoffs.
Volunteer Details and Incentives
The Bills are offering compensation of $20 per hour for those who participate in the snow shoveling effort. Interested individuals must be at least 18 years old and are encouraged to sign up in advance, as only pre-registered volunteers are guaranteed work. The first 500 fans to register will receive a pair of Highmark Stadium branded winter gloves, while those aged 21 and older will be eligible for winter hats provided in partnership with Bud Light. In addition to payment, food and hot beverages will be available for all participants.
Official Statements & Responses
The Bills organization has emphasized the importance of community involvement in this effort, stating that the assistance will help ensure a safe and accessible environment for fans attending the game. The team is also preparing for a transition to a new Highmark Stadium, set to open in 2026, which is expected to require less snow removal due to its design.
Criticism & Opposition
While the initiative has generally been well-received, some critics have raised concerns about the appropriateness of asking fans to perform labor for a professional sports team. They argue that the team should have adequate resources to manage snow removal without relying on volunteer efforts.
